Thomas "Tony" Anthony Clark, 52, of Vancleave, died Monday, August 28, 2017 at his home.
He was a loving and giving person that would do anything for anybody. He was always full of laughter and was very dedicated to his family and church, especially his grandchildren. He was an avid animal lover.
He will be best remembered as being strong willed full of laughs and jokes sharing his knowledge. He always had a joke and a laugh wanting to help others before himself and lift others up in the scriptures. He adored his church ward family especially the scriptures and his Bishopric. He also enjoyed his motorcycle and guns, fishing, and hot rod cars.
He is preceded in death by his step father, Hugh Ellis Wyatt.
Survivors include his wife of 25 years, Eva Clark; children, Valerie (Charlie) Hale and Anthony Clark; mother Sandra Saltarelli; father, Carl W. Clark, Jr.; brother, Carl W. Clark, III (Pam); grandchildren, Elisabeth Hale, Haley Hale, and Mason Hale, and his nephews, Stephen and Chad Clark . He is also survived by his adoring dogs, Treue, Gunner, Sky, Willie, Freckles, Chief, and Titan.
A celebration of life service will be held at 2 pm on Saturday, September 2, 2017 at The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day Saints, 14928 Big Ridge Road, Biloxi, Mississippi 39532.
The family will receive friends from 1 pm until service time at the church.
